An Employee Clicked a Phishing Link. Do These Things in This Order.

Someone on your team just came to you, embarrassed, and said the sentence every business owner dreads: "I think I clicked something I shouldn't have."

First, before anything else: they did the right thing by telling you, and how you react right now determines whether the next person speaks up or hides it. Phishing that gets reported in five minutes is an incident. Phishing that gets hidden for three days is a disaster. Say thank you, mean it, and get to work.

Here's the order of operations.

1. Figure out what "clicked" means

The word covers four different situations with four different severities. Ask calmly:

  • Clicked a link but entered nothing. Lowest severity. The page may have tried to run something in the browser, but most of the time a click alone means little. Don't relax yet, but don't panic.
  • Clicked and typed in a password. This is credential theft, and it's now a race. Assume the attacker is trying that password within minutes.
  • Clicked and downloaded or opened a file. Possible malware on the machine. The computer is now suspect.
  • Clicked and approved a sign-in prompt or MFA request. The attacker may have a live session right now. Treat it like a stolen password, urgently.

2. If a password went in: change it, then kill the sessions

Change the password on the affected account immediately. Then, and people skip this, sign out all active sessions for that account, because changing a password doesn't always evict someone who's already logged in. If that same password is reused anywhere else, and be honest, it usually is, change it there too. Turn on multi-factor authentication if it wasn't already on.

Then check the mailbox rules on that account. Attackers who get into email almost immediately create forwarding or auto-delete rules so they can watch quietly. A rule the user didn't create is confirmation you had a visitor.

3. If a file was opened: get the machine off the network

Disconnect it from Wi-Fi or unplug the cable. Don't power it off, just isolate it, since powering off can destroy the evidence of what ran. If you have endpoint detection on the machine, this is its moment: check what it flagged. If your antivirus is whatever came free with the computer, assume you don't actually know what's on the machine, because you don't.

4. Look at what the account could reach

An email account is rarely the target. It's the doorway. Think about what flowed through that mailbox: invoices, wire instructions, payroll changes, customer data, password resets for other systems. If the account touched money conversations, call, don't email, the other parties in any recent payment thread and confirm nothing changed. Invoice fraud from a watched mailbox is how small businesses lose five and six figures, and the window to catch a fraudulent wire is measured in hours.

5. Write down what happened

Date, time, who, what was clicked, what was done about it. Twenty minutes of notes while it's fresh. If this turns out to be bigger than it looked, that record is what your insurer, your bank, and any regulator will ask for first. If your business handles regulated data, patient records, tax files, client financials, an incident record isn't optional paperwork. It's the difference between "we responded properly" and taking their word for it.

6. Afterward: fix the system, not the person

One more time, because it matters: the employee is not the problem. Phishing works on smart, careful people, and the businesses that punish clicks just train their staff to stop reporting. The useful questions afterward are system questions. Why did the email get through? Would MFA have stopped this? Would anything on the computer have caught the download? Does anyone watch for suspicious sign-ins, or did you only find out because a human confessed?

That last question is the uncomfortable one. Everything in this checklist assumes you found out. The incidents that do real damage are the ones nobody reports because nobody noticed.
